Transaction 627504ee1ea61cd1678e65bbbe3df37484e1255ff649be2efac5a82731f685a1

1 Input
2 Outputs
  • 627504ee1ea61cd1678e65bbbe3df37484e1255ff649be2efac5a82731f685a1:0
  • value  1354692
    address  3M4k2w7svyeX3bbYqgu2VMxFbycuhKKvLV
  • 627504ee1ea61cd1678e65bbbe3df37484e1255ff649be2efac5a82731f685a1:1
  • value  10285764
    address  3BKB5TSyq9M3sL8XNosunvrzuMD5UNaydP